Abstract

Transformation of productive Human Resource is the new concept developed by the researcher; it is the process of transforming unproductive Human Resource into productive Human Resource and thereby stimulating economic development by taking all the advantages of Human Resource. The transformation of productive Human Resource is the function of GDP growth rate, population growth rate, the nature of population growth rate, transformation of surplus labour force from agriculture to other sectors, industrial development, development of tertiary sector, Advancement in education, Urbanization, foreign capital investment and the export trade. The study finds three stages in the process of economic development of any developing economy.
